Nestled among the trees, Cimarron Apartments offers a serene retreat from the hustle and bustle of urban living while being just minutes from downtown Denver. Located in the heart of the Congress Park neighborhood, our community is within walking distance of the beautiful Botanic Gardens, as well as charming restaurants, coffee shops, and unique gift shops. Cimarron Apartments boasts a range of amenities, including a sauna, fitness center, and a popular grill on our rooftop sundeck. Enjoy breathtaking views of the Rocky Mountains and downtown Denver while spending leisure time with friends and family. For your convenience, we offer assigned off-street parking, laundry facilities, and elevator access. Our inviting apartment homes feature air conditioning, hot water heat, cozy fireplaces with brick hearths, and updated kitchens with dishwashers. Additionally, our professionally managed, non-smoking building ensures a comfortable living environment for all residents.
